1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a method on the web in which a protracted URL could be converted into a shorter, additional manageable type. This shortened URL redirects to the initial long URL when visited. Expert services like Bitly and TinyURL are very well-identified examples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the appearance of social media platforms like Twitter, in which character boundaries for posts created it tricky to share very long URLs.

2. Core Elements of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ener usually includes the subsequent components:

World-wide-web Interface: This is the front-stop aspect wherever end users can enter their long URLs and acquire shortened versions. It could be an easy form on the Online page.
Database: A database is essential to retail outlet the mapping among the original lengthy URL and the shortened Model.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L choices like MongoDB can be utilized.
Redirection Logic: Here is the backend logic that normally takes the limited URL and redirects the person towards the corresponding prolonged URL. This logic is generally carried out in the net server or an software layer.
API: Many URL shorteners deliver an API to ensure that 3rd-party apps can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the original prolonged URLs.
3. Designing the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ting a lengthy URL into a brief just one. Numerous methods could be used, which include:

Hashing: The very long URL can be hashed into a set-size string, which serves because the quick URL. However, hash collisions (diverse URLs resulting in the identical hash) need to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: One particular common approach is to work with Base62 encoding (which takes advantage of 62 figures: 0-9, A-Z, and also a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ds on the entry from the databases. This process makes certain that the brief URL is as brief as is possible.
Random String Technology: An additional solution would be to make a random string of a hard and fast duration (e.g., 6 figures) and Verify if it’s by now in use in the database. If not, it’s assigned on the extended URL.
four. Databases Management
The database schema for any URL shortener is normally clear-cut, with two primary fields:

ID: A novel identifier for every URL entry.
Extended URL: The first URL that needs to be shortened.
Shorter URL/Slug: The limited Model from the URL, normally stored as a singular string.
In addition to these, it is advisable to retail store metadata such as the development day, expiration day, and the quantity of instances the small URL continues to be accessed.

5. Managing Redirection
Redirection is a vital Section of the URL shortener's Procedure. When a consumer clicks on a brief URL, the service must swiftly retrieve the first URL in the database and redirect the consumer working with an HTTP 301 (permanent redirect) or 302 (non permanent redirect) status code.

Performance is vital here, as the method ought to be just about instantaneous. Methods like databases indexing and caching (e.g., using Redis or Memcached) might be used to speed up the retrieval course of action.

6. Safety Criteria
Security is a major issue in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ener could be abused to distribute destructive hyperlinks. Applying UR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-party safety expert services to examine URLs before shortening them can mitigate this danger.
Spam Prevention: Fee restricting and CAPTCHA can reduce abuse by spammers attempting to make Countless shorter URLs.
seven. Scalability
Because the URL shortener grows, it might need to deal with an incredible number of URLs and redirect requests. This needs a scalable architecture, quite possibly invol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ute targeted visitors throughout various servers to take care of significant hundreds.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ases that can sc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Separate concerns like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into distinctive services to improve scalability and maintainability.
eight. Analytics
URL shorteners typically give analytics to track how frequently a brief URL is clicked, the place the site visitors is coming from, and also other helpful metrics. This requires logging each redirect And maybe integrating with analytics platforms.
